I think it's already past that point, the pins are wearing into the metal on the hinges. I should of replaced the pins and bushings a long time ago.
 
According to the instructions....

If the inner hinge holes are worn larger than .470" it is time to get another hinge.

Regardless, the repair kit for the MN12 and FN10 are the same.
